Product Overview

Understanding the core offerings of YouCam and ModiFace is crucial to appreciating their distinct value propositions.

YouCam AI & AR Business Solutions

YouCam, developed by Perfect Corp., is a comprehensive suite of AI Beauty Tech solutions designed for brands and retailers. It has its roots in the popular consumer-facing YouCam Makeup app, which gave it a massive dataset for training its AI models. YouCam's portfolio is extensive, covering everything from makeup and hair to skin and accessories. Their key offerings include:

  • AI Virtual Makeup Try-On: Realistic, real-time try-on for lipstick, foundation, eyeshadow, and more.
  • AI Skin Analysis: An advanced diagnostic tool that detects up to 14 skin concerns and provides personalized product recommendations.
  • AI Virtual Hair Color Try-On: Allows users to experiment with a wide range of hair colors and styles.
  • AI Face Analyzer: Provides insights into user facial attributes to offer tailored product suggestions.
  • AI-Powered Foundation Shade Finder: Helps consumers find their perfect foundation match from the comfort of their homes.

YouCam positions itself as an agile, all-in-one solutions provider for brands of all sizes, emphasizing ease of integration and a broad feature set.

ModiFace

ModiFace was founded by academics from Stanford University and the University of Toronto, giving it a strong foundation in scientific research and computer vision. Acquired by L'Oréal in 2018, it has become the powerhouse behind the digital experiences of L'Oréal's extensive portfolio of brands, including Lancôme, Maybelline, and Urban Decay. ModiFace is renowned for its clinical-grade realism and accuracy. Its core products include:

  • Makeup Virtual Try-On: Highly realistic simulations for a wide range of cosmetic products.
  • AI-Powered Skin Diagnostics: A dermatologist-reviewed tool for analyzing skin conditions and tracking changes over time.
  • Hair Color & Style Simulation: Enables virtual testing of hair colors with a focus on photorealistic results.
  • Live Video Consultations: An API that allows beauty advisors to conduct one-on-one virtual consultations with customers.

ModiFace's deep integration with L'Oréal makes it an enterprise-focused solution, prioritizing scientific validation and seamless integration within a large corporate ecosystem.

Integration & API Capabilities

The ability to seamlessly integrate into existing digital ecosystems is a critical factor for businesses.

YouCam provides a highly flexible integration framework. They offer turn-key solutions for popular e-commerce platforms like Shopify and Magento, as well as robust SDKs and APIs for custom web, mobile app, and even in-store smart mirror integrations. Their documentation is comprehensive, catering to developers looking for quick implementation. This makes YouCam a versatile choice for a wide range of businesses, from D2C startups to established retailers.

ModiFace, while also offering APIs and SDKs, operates more like a strategic technology partner, especially for L'Oréal's brands. The integration is often deeper and more customized, tailored to the specific needs of large enterprise clients. Their technology is embedded across L'Oréal's brand websites, apps, and even platforms like Amazon and Google. While accessible to non-L'Oréal brands, the process may be more involved, reflecting their focus on large-scale, high-fidelity deployments.

Real-World Use Cases

Both platforms have been adopted by some of the biggest names in the beauty industry.

  • YouCam has partnered with a diverse range of brands, including Estée Lauder, MAC Cosmetics, Target, and Benefit Cosmetics. These brands leverage YouCam's technology for website VTO, in-store smart mirrors, and special digital campaigns to drive engagement and sales.
  • ModiFace is the exclusive technology provider for L'Oréal's 30+ brands, such as Lancôme, Giorgio Armani, and Maybelline. A prominent use case is their deployment on Amazon, where shoppers can virtually try on makeup products directly on the product detail page, a feature that has significantly boosted conversions.

Alternative Tools Overview

While YouCam and ModiFace are leaders, other players exist in the market:

  • Banuba: A technology company that provides an AR SDK for developers to build their own beauty apps. It's more of a technology provider than an end-to-end solution.
  • Perfect365: Similar to YouCam, it started as a consumer app and now offers digital makeup solutions for brands, though it has a smaller market share.
  • Proprietary In-House Solutions: Some large brands, like Sephora, have developed their own in-house AR try-on technology (Sephora Virtual Artist) to maintain full control over the user experience.
